  1. A Local Song

    L stands for Lismore, Dear town of my birth. To me she is the fairest, And best upon earth.

    And though in all others. I cheerfully roam
    I never forget Old Lismore is my home
    O dear town of Lismore You lie peacefully there
    With your old ancient castle Pointing up to the sky
    And the river Blackwater Flowing silenting by.
    Dear town of my birth.
    I always shall love you.
    You are in my thoughts.
    Every night, every day. May God and his mother
    Always protect you
